Do-it-Yourself Roof, Is it Advisable? Some Tips and Guidelines

Ask any of them, installing roofings or fixing them is an unexciting and trying job, however somebody has actually got to do it. When it comes to house protection versus nature's elements, the roof is one of the most important elements.

The roofing system of your house is an important part of your home; they provide security from the rain, snow, sleet, hail, and the sun's light and heat. Typically, a roof consists of the roofing product used for the primary cover, the frame where the will be attached, and other aspects and components. Building or repairing a roofing can be really intricate or very basic job, this will depend on the style and surface of your roofing system.

Yes it's less expensive when you slash the labor expenses but if you don't have the essential abilities and know how, it may just cost you more in the end. Take a deep great look on your skills, tools and the time you can pay for, a roofing system needs to be completed right away, you don't desire your home exposed to severe weather condition conditions and to burglars. Structure or fixing a roof needs special tools, you can buy some however that would be impractical, you may also rent them but if you harm them you'll still have to pay for them, keep in mind if your not familiar with the tools don't utilize them or at least be careful.

Always be mindful when it comes to structure or repairing things. You are using hazardous tools and you might injure yourself, this is especially thought about when doing roofs given that your high in the air. patient when structure or fixing the roof. Which might cost you more if you go too fast you might get puzzled and end up with more errors. Be wary of your tools, follow the instructions provided and make certain that you unplug them when not in usage or when changing blades or drill bits. Use ears and eyes security always; use protective clothing and gears such as heavy soled boots. Make certain that when you deal with the roof, it is water complimentary and not slippery, tidy up scraps and dirt so as not to slip on them. Do not force yourself; in case a product is slippery or too heavy get some support. Keep in mind; strategy ahead so you can be all set for anything and everything. Building something by yourself provides terrific pride and happiness after its completion, however take whatever into factor to consider for your own sake. Because you have simply offered a roof for your household, when you have actually done your roof you might stand back and appreciate it.

Flat Roofs

Flat roofs are a great method to keep a building safe from water. Knowing exactly what to do with a flat roofing will ensure you have a working roof system that will last a long time.

might look excellent, and are very common, flat roofs do need regular upkeep and comprehensive repair work in order to efficiently avoid water seepage. correctly, you'll enjoy with your flat roof for a very long time.

Flat roofing systems aren't as popular and/or attractive as its more recent counterparts, such as copper, tile, or slate roofs. They are just as important and require even more attention. In order to avoid getting rid of cash on short-term repair work, you must know exactly how flat roofing systems are developed, the various types of flat roofing systems that are offered, and the value of routine examination and maintenance.

A flat roofing system works by providing a water resistant membrane over a structure. It includes one or more layers of hydrophobic materials that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is typically placed between roofing membrane.

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other building components to prevent water infiltration. The water is then directed to drains, downspouts, and gutters by the roofing system's minor pitch.

There are four most common kinds of flat roof systems. Listed in order of increasing toughness and expense,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, built-up or multiple-ply,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is used over and existing roof, to $20 per square foot or more for brand-new metal roofings.

Utilized considering that the 1890s, asphalt roll roof normally includes one layer of asphalt-saturated natural or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roof fel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and typically covered with a granular mineral surface area. The joints are usually covered over with a roofing compound. It can last about 10 years.

Single-ply membrane roof is the latest type of roofing material. It is typically utilized to change multiple-ply roofs. 10 to 12 year guarantees are common, but proper setup is vital and upkeep is still required.

Multiple-ply or built-up roofing, also known as BUR, is made of overlapping rolls of saturated or coated felts or mats that are sprinkled with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roofing sheet, tile, or ballast pavers that are utilized to secure the hidden products from the weather. BURs are created to last 10 to 30 years, which depends on the products used.

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a covering of asphalt or coal tar. Given that the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es examining and preserving the seams of the roofing hard.

Flat-seamed roofs have been used given that the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last lots of years depending on the quality of the direct exposure, upkeep, and material to the aspects.

Galvanized metal does need routine painting in order to avoid deterioration and split joints require to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can become pitted and pinholed from acid raid and usually needs repl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are favored as lasting flat roofings.
